Mauritius has set off to expand and upgrade its airport with the help of China. It will take a loan of US$ 260 million (207 million euros) from China. China has been investing heavily in oil and mineral-rich African countries for some time and it has been looking forward to extend its ties with the smaller economies of the continent.
